Psalm 110
The Priestly King
A psalm of David.
1 This is the declaration of the Lord
to my Lord:
“Sit at my right hand
until I make your enemies your footstool.”(A)

Mark 16:19
Christian Standard Bible
The Ascension
19 So the Lord Jesus, after speaking to them,(A) was taken up into heaven(B) and sat down at the right hand(C) of God.

Acts 2:33-34
Christian Standard Bible
33 Therefore, since he has been exalted to the right hand of God(A) and has received from the Father the promised Holy Spirit,(B) he has poured out(C) what you both see and hear. 34 For it was not David who ascended into the heavens, but he himself says:
The Lord declared to my Lord,
‘Sit at my right hand

Hebrews 10:12
Christian Standard Bible
12 But this man, after offering one sacrifice for sins forever, sat down at the right hand of God.[a](A)
